sTARTUp Lab presents: Pitching ABC
In this STARTERtartu programme workshop, participants gain basic knowledge and skills of storytelling and pitching. You will learn how to best represent your product, service, what mistakes to avoid, how to stand on the stage, how to deal with stage fright and how to leave a memorable impression to different groups of listeners.
sTARTUp Lab presents: Business Model Canvas
In this workshop of STARTERtartu programme participants gain knowledge and skills on how to create a Business Model Canvas (BMC) and use it throughout the idea development process. BMC is a global standard used by millions of people in companies of all sizes to put a business model on one page
